How the 2025 ENERGY STAR standards change water and energy use for washers in Dallas‑Fort Worth and Houston

The 2025 ENERGY STAR criteria accelerate the shift toward much lower water-per-cycle and better hot‑water management in residential washers. Practically, that means the newest qualified front‑load and high‑efficiency top‑load models are engineered to use roughly 10–15 gallons per wash cycle, compared with many legacy top‑load models that use 25–40 gallons. For a typical renter or small family doing 200–350 loads a year, swapping a 30‑gallon older washer for a 12‑gallon ENERGY STAR 2025‑compliant unit saves about 5,400–6,500 gallons annually. At common combined water+sewer rates seen across DFW and Houston utility districts ($6–$20 per 1,000 gallons depending on provider and tier), that translates to roughly $35–$130 in direct water/sewer savings per year — savings that are realized immediately with a compliant machine and are easier to capture through a lease than through replacing an aging unit.

Energy savings under the 2025 standard mainly come from reduced hot‑water demand and smarter cycle controls; ENERGY STAR‑qualified washers now emphasize cold‑wash performance and shorter fill times to cut water‑heating load. In many Texas homes where water heaters are electric, each gallon of hot water avoided can represent meaningful electric use — a household that reduces hot‑water consumption by 20–40% for washing could see water‑heating energy drops roughly equivalent to 100–300 kWh/year, depending on wash temperature choices and load counts. With residential electricity prices in Texas often ranging from about $0.10–$0.16/kWh depending on provider and plan, that can be another $10–$50 saved per year; with gas water heaters the savings show up as lower gas bills. Are compact, stacked, and coin‑op washers in rental and multifamily properties required to meet 2025 ENERGY STAR criteria in DFW and Houston

There is no statewide Texas law that automatically requires every residential or multifamily washer to meet ENERGY STAR 2025 criteria, but enforcement is driven by program rules and property requirements. Municipal building codes in Dallas–Fort Worth and Houston do not, on their own, mandate ENERGY STAR certification for every in‑unit washer; however, utility rebate programs, low‑income housing tax credit projects, HUD financing, and many property management procurement policies do require ENERGY STAR or equivalent performance to qualify. In practice that means a 200‑unit garden apartment that wants a utility rebate or to meet a lender’s green requirement will typically need machines that meet the 2025 ENERGY STAR specification within the project’s retrofit window (often 6–18 months), so managers should plan procurement accordingly. Compact and stacked washers are treated the same way by requirements: the washer module itself must meet the ENERGY STAR residential criteria if a program or policy calls for certified residential washers. Compact machines are usually 24″ wide, 24–27″ deep, and have tub capacities around 1.6–2.5 cubic feet versus standard washers at 3.5–5.0 cu ft; many compact models do not meet the stricter 2025 thresholds because smaller tubs and shorter cycles make it harder to hit the updated Modified Energy Factor and water‑use metrics. Coin‑op and commercial laundry machines are a separate category: common‑area washers in a multifamily laundry room are classified as commercial clothes washers and must meet the ENERGY STAR commercial clothes washer specification to qualify for most commercial incentives and to maximize utility savings. Commercial machines are sized by load weight (often 20–50 lb capacity), and energy/water performance is measured per cycle; switching from older coin‑op washers to ENERGY STAR commercial washers typically cuts water use by 15–30% and can reduce gas/electric by a similar range, translating to operating savings of roughly $500–$2,000 per machine per year depending on occupancy and regional utility rates. Local utility rebates and incentives in North Texas and Houston for ENERGY STAR 2025 washing machines and how leasing through a local provider like PAL affects eligibility

Across North Texas and the Houston area, utility and municipal incentive programs routinely offer cash rebates for ENERGY STAR–qualified clothes washers; residential rebates for qualifying front‑load or high‑efficiency top‑load machines typically fall in the $50–$200 range, while commercial or multifamily/coin‑op programs can offer $200–$500 per unit. In Houston service territory, CenterPoint Energy and municipal water/efficiency programs have historically supported appliance rebates, and in the Dallas‑Fort Worth region Oncor‑served customers and retail electric providers (TXU, Reliant and others) or city water utilities sometimes run parallel incentives. Most programs updated for 2025 performance criteria will target models that meet the new ENERGY STAR thresholds and will list eligible model numbers; rebate processing times are commonly 6–12 weeks after application approval and submission of final invoices.

To qualify for these rebates customers usually must submit the model number, serial number, a dated invoice showing purchase/installation address within the utility’s service territory, and proof of installation or disposal of the old unit in some programs. Common administrative rules: pre‑approval is required on larger commercial or multifamily incentives (start the application 2–4 weeks before purchase), residential rebate forms must be submitted within 60–90 days of purchase, and some water utility rebates require the washer to reduce Water Factor to a program‑specified level. Next‑day, code‑compliant installation is a key operational benefit of leasing through a local full‑service provider. Residential front‑load washers need the standard 3/4″ female hose connections, an appropriate drain standpipe (installers commonly set standpipe heights around 30–36 inches to avoid siphoning), and a 120V dedicated circuit; stacked or compact setups require clearances that typically start at 24–27 inches in width and 30–34 inches of cabinet depth. Dryers require proper venting with 4‑inch smooth metal ducting and common manufacturer limits of about 25 feet of equivalent duct length (shortened for each elbow). Routine maintenance and emergency repairs are more frequent in Texas because heat and high humidity accelerate wear, promote corrosion in water valves and hoses, and increase lint and condensation in vent paths. The typical out‑of‑pocket repair for a homeowner — parts and labor — runs roughly $125–$300 per visit; dryer vent cleanings cost $90–$200 and should be done annually in humid climates to prevent lint buildup and efficiency loss.
